Yury Svyatoslavich or Georgy Svyatoslavovich ( Russian: Юрий Святославович or Георгий Святославович) was the last sovereign ruler of the Principality of Smolensk and Bryansk (1386–95, 1401–04) whose life was spent in vain attempts to fend off aggression by the Grand Duchy of Lithuania .     Yuri Alekseevich Gagarin was born on March 9, 1934, the third of four children of Aleksey Ivanovich and Anna Gagarin. The family lived on a collective farm in Klushino, Russia, where his father was a carpenter and his mother was a dairy-maid. Gagarin grew up helping them with their work.     In 1961 Yuri Gagarin made history as the first human to travel in space. The distinction of being the first living creature to orbit in space, however, is held by a Russian dog named Laika (Barker).     Although ejecting from a spacecraft was standard procedure for Vostok pilots, Soviet officials reported that Gagarin had remained aboard all the way to the ground. This was required for international certification of the Vostokflight as a record. Gagarin never revealed the truth, and for many decades the Soviets concealed the actual facts of the la...
